2WAY REMOTE STARTER/ ALARM OWNER’S GUIDE Page 3 Remote Start - Automatic Transmission 1 2 34 1. Press and release button #3. 2. The park lights will flash and the siren will chirp one time. 3. The vehicle will then remote start. The park lights will flash four times then remain on while the vehicle is running. The run timer on the LCD will begin to countdown. 4. The vehicle will continue to run for the programmed runtime*. Never remote start if the vehicle is parked in a Garage.
OWNER’S GUIDE 2way REMOTE STARTER/ ALARM Page 4 Idle Mode 1 2 34 1. While the vehicle is running with key, press button #3. 2. The park lights will turn on and the siren will chirp once. 3. Turn the ignition key off and the vehicle will continue to run. 4. Exit the vehicle and leave it running safely without leaving the keys in the Ignition. Note: Always lock the doors while the vehicle is left running unattended.
2WAY REMOTE STARTER/ ALARM OWNER’S GUIDE Page 5 Reservation Mode- Manual Transmission Only Manual transmission remote starters must be set into Reservation Mode before the remote starter will activate. There are two different ways to place the system into Reservation Mode. The activation type of Reservation Mode is determined when the system is installed. The default setting is Auto Reservation Mode.
OWNER’S GUIDE Page 6 2way REMOTE STARTER/ ALARM Lock Doors and Arm Alarm 1 2 34 1.Press and release button #1 on the remote transmitter. 2.The park lights will flash and the siren will chirp one time. 3.The doors will lock. 4.The LEDs on the antenna will start flashing within five seconds. Note: If installed, the starter disable will activate. * To Lock/Arm without chirps, press #1 and #2 at the same time. OWNER’S GUIDE 2way REMOTE STARTER/ ALARM Page 8 Siren On/Off 1 2 34 When this feature is programmed on the siren will only activate when the alarm is triggered or if the Car Finder is activated. 1. Press and hold button #4 until the Timer Mode icon begins to flash. 2. Press and release button #1 four times or until the siren icon begins to flash. 3. To turn the siren Off press button #2. Press button #4 to exit. To turn the siren back on, press button #3 while the siren icon is flashing.
2WAY REMOTE STARTER/ ALARM OWNER’S GUIDE Page 9 Cold Start/Timer Mode 1 2 34 Cold Start Mode will start the vehicle at a user selectable start interval or temperature setting. The vehicle can be set to start once every 1, 2, 3 or 4 hours in Timer Mode or to start at 0,-5,-15 or -25 Celsius in Temperature Mode (LT Models Only) for a maximum 12 starts. The vehicle will start at the selected start interval/ temperature and run for the programmed runtime (Normally 15min).

OWNER’S GUIDE 2way REMOTE STARTER/ ALARM Page 12 Shock Sensor Programming/ Adjustment Press and hold buttons #1 and #2 for three seconds. The park lights will flash and the siren will three times. 1 2 34 While the park lights are on strike the vehicle with the amount of force wanted to trigger the alarm*. Hit the vehicle with the same amount of force three time, the siren will chirp each time the system detects the Impact.
2WAY REMOTE STARTER/ ALARM OWNER’S GUIDE Page 13 Setting The Time (On equipped models only) 1 2 34 1) Press and hold buttons #1 and #4 until the minute portion of the clock begins to flash. 2) To set the minute, press button #3 to increase and button #2 to decrease the minute. 3) To set the hour, press button #1 and the hour portion of the clock will begin to flash. 4) To set the hour, press button #3 to increase and button #2 to decrease the hour.
OWNER’S GUIDE 2way REMOTE STARTER/ ALARM Page 14 Service Mode ATTENTION: TO AVOID SERIOUS INJURY, this remote start system must be set into Service Mode before any under hood servicing is started. Service Mode will prevent the vehicle from starting while the vehicle is being serviced. It is the sole responsibility of the vehicle’s owner to place the system into Service Mode. The manufacture accepts no responsibility for accidental starting of the vehicle while the vehicle is being serviced.
2WAY REMOTE STARTER/ ALARM OWNER ’S GUIDE Page 15 Diagnostics/ Diagnostics Chart If the remote starter does not activate when button #3 is pressed the park lights will flash a diagnostic to indicate what shutdown input has been triggered. Example when the start button is pressed the park lights flash 3 times slowly. Looking at the chart below this would indicate that the system is in Service Mode.
